Biochem Physiol Actions: SSTR2 (Somatostatin receptor 2) is a regulatory peptide widely distributed in tissues. It is involved in several cellular functions including, neuroendocrine and exocrine secretions, and proliferation. In neuronal tissues, it interacts with the inhibitory G-proteins in both the chambers, presynaptic and postsynaptic, to control the synaptic responses. It has the ability to control the proliferation of both normal and neoplastic cells. It is abundantly present at the plasma membrane of several tumorous cells such as pancreatic, gastrointestinal, breast carcinoma, neuroblastomas etc. Thus, SSTR2 has been proved as a potential prognostic marker for certain malignancies.
